In-Text If he that hath not the Spirit of Christ is none of his you may say, Whose is he then? If they be none of Christ's that have not his Spirit, whose are they? They are all his whose Spirit rules them, every one of us doth belong to him whose Spirit ruleth over us, If he that hath not the Spirit of christ is none of his you may say, Whose is he then?
